Former San Francisco 49ers defensive tackle Dana Stubblefield was found guilty of rape Monday.
Robert Salonga of the Mercury News reported the news, noting Stubblefield was found guilty of raping a woman he invited to his home to interview as a prospective babysitter. He was found guilty of rape with threat of a gun.
In March, Salonga reported the trial began approximately four years after the former 49er was charged with sexually assaulting a developmentally disabled woman. On Monday, Salonga reported the "jury does not convict on charges that Jane Doe was mentally unable to legally consent to sex but was convinced a rape occurred.
